FJ07 CCV is a 2007 Fiat Ducato in White with a 2,199c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.3%.
Across all 2007 Fiat Ducato models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.0% with a typical mileage of 44,758 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Fiat Ducato f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 34,174 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FJ07 CCV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Ducato typ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 19 years old, this Fiat Ducato is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
